Built-in Timer and Scheduling Features in Ceiling Fans

Utility of Built-in Timers in Ceiling Fans

Built-in timers in ceiling fans offer a convenient way to control the fan’s operating duration. With a timer, you can program the fan to turn on or off automatically at specific times, eliminating the need for manual operation. This is particularly useful when you want the fan to turn on or off while you are away or during specific time periods, such as during the night when you are sleeping. Built-in timers help maximize energy savings by ensuring the fan is only running when needed, reducing unnecessary energy consumption.

Utility of Scheduling Features in Ceiling Fans

Scheduling features in ceiling fans take the convenience of built-in timers to the next level. With scheduling features, you can not only set specific times for the fan to turn on or off, but also program recurring schedules. For example, you can set different schedules for weekdays and weekends, or even create specific schedules for each day of the week. This allows for even greater control over the fan’s operation, ensuring it operates efficiently based on your daily routine. Scheduling features are especially useful for busy individuals who may forget to turn the fan on or off manually, as they provide a seamless and automated solution.

Comparing Smart Ceiling Fans with Energy-Efficient Ceiling Fans

What are Smart Ceiling Fans?

Smart ceiling fans are a type of ceiling fan that can be controlled and automated through smart home systems, such as voice assistants or mobile apps. These fans are equipped with Wi-Fi or Bluetooth connectivity, allowing for seamless integration with smart home platforms. Smart ceiling fans offer advanced features and customization options beyond traditional energy-efficient ceiling fans.

Differences Between Smart Ceiling Fans and Energy-Efficient Fans

While both smart ceiling fans and energy-efficient ceiling fans provide energy-saving benefits, there are some key differences between the two:

  1. Control and Automation: Smart ceiling fans offer advanced control and automation capabilities through smart home systems, allowing for voice commands, remote control, and integration with other smart devices. Energy-efficient ceiling fans typically have built-in timers and scheduling features for automated operation but lack the extensive connectivity options of smart fans.
  2. Customization: Smart ceiling fans provide a higher level of customization, such as adjustable speed settings, personalized scheduling, and programmable modes. Energy-efficient ceiling fans usually offer limited customization options, focusing primarily on energy efficiency and optimizing airflow.
  3. Cost: Smart ceiling fans tend to have a higher upfront cost compared to energy-efficient ceiling fans due to the added technology and connectivity features. However, the potential energy savings and convenience of smart control may justify the higher investment for some consumers.
  4. Ease of Use: Energy-efficient ceiling fans with built-in timers and scheduling features are generally easy to set up and operate without the need for extensive technical knowledge. Smart ceiling fans may require more initial setup and configuration to integrate with smart home platforms.
